Venezuelan 26-goal Gold Cup

Caracas remains undefeated in

Venezuelan Gold Cup

By Alex Webbe

Caracas Polo (Victor Vargas, Toto Collardin, Juan Brane and Pablo Jauretche) won

their second straight game in the 26-goal Gold Cup in Venezuela this afternoon by

defeating Agualinda (Sebastian Harriot, Agustin Canale, Martin Espain and Juan

Harriot) 10-6.

The victory is Caracas Polo’s second of the tournament, having defeated Tucacas

(Facundo Castagnola, Santiago Cernadas, Toto Urturi and Marcelo Frayssinet) 7-5 in

the tournament opener.  Agualinda knocked off Tucacas 7-6 in the second match of the

Gold Cup, handing Tucacas its second loss of the tournament and eliminating it from

the competition.

Agualinda, with a 1-1 record, has earned a rematch with Caracas Polo and will face

them in the finals on Wednesday, October 2 for the championship.

High goal action will resume at the Caracas Polo Club on Friday, September 27the with

six teams playing in three separate matches in 22-goal competition.

The finals of the 22-goal god Cup will conclude with an October 5th final.
